Excerpt from Bibliography of History for Schools and Libraries: With Descriptive and Critical Annotations Gross, are limited in range and compiled without particular reference to the needs of teachers in schools or even in the lower college grades, and the general reader and ordinary user of the public library are apt to find themselves lost in the mazes of these heavy special works. The distinctive features of the present volume are: (1) its comprehensiveness, as covering the whole field of history; (2) its brevity and the selective character of the lists; (3) the classification and arrangement, following the lines of the historical curriculum most in favor at the present day; (4) the annotations, provided in the case of nearly every work listed, describing impartially and critically the character, scope and importance of each; (5) its unique value for the elementary teacher, as containing the only annotated list of history books for children yet published; (6) the cooperative character, being prepared by representatives of the teaching of history in the university, the high school, and the elementary school. Because of these features, and of the interest manifested in the work during its serial publication in incomplete form, it is believed the Bibliography will supply a real need of teachers both in elementary and secondary schools, and will be useful to college instructors as well; that in the high school and college it may be used to advantage by students in connection with their regular work; and that it will prove service able to the general reader, to the student working alone, and in the public library. This bibliography lists books (including pamphlets), theses (including some Master of Education major papers), and articles. Where possible, these sources have been sorted into the following time frames: the colonial period: 1849 to 1871; the late 19th century and early 20th century: 1872 to 1918; the interwar years: 1919 to 1939; the forties and fifties; and the sixties to the present.
